description
These devices are positive-edge-triggered D-type flip-flops with a common enable input. The ’HCT273 are similar to the ’HCT377, but feature a common clear enable (CLR
) input instead of a
latched clock. Information at the data (D) inputs meeting the
setup time requirements is transferred to the Q outputs on the positive-going edge of the clock (CLK) pulse. Clock triggering occurs at a particular voltage level and is not directly related to the positive-going pulse. When CLK is at either the high or low level, the D input has no effect at the output. The circuits are designed to prevent false clocking by transitions at CLR
.
The SN54HCT273 is characterized for operation over the full military temperature range of –55°C to 125°C. The SN74HCT273 is characterized for operation from –40°C to 85°C.
